Types of Varuna Pumps
There are different types of Varuna Pumps, each made for a specific use. Some of the common types include:
1. Submersible Pumps
These pumps are placed inside water sources like boreholes or wells. They are powerful and can pump water from deep underground.

2. Centrifugal Pumps
These pumps are best for surface water. They are used for irrigation, homes, and industries. They move water quickly and efficiently.
3. Open-Well Pumps
Open-well pumps are designed for open wells. They are simple to use and work well in rural areas where open wells are common.
4. Solar-Powered Pumps
Solar pumps are a great option for places without electricity. They use solar energy to pump water, making them cost-effective and eco-friendly.

How to Choose the Right Varuna Pump
Choosing the right pump depends on your needs. Here are some tips to help you choose:
1. Know the Water Source
If your water source is deep underground, you need a submersible pump. For surface water, a centrifugal pump may be better.
2. Check the Water Demand
If you need a lot of water, choose a pump with high capacity. For small uses, a smaller pump will work well.
3. Consider Power Options
If electricity is a problem in your area, a solar-powered Varuna Pump is a great choice.
